No, School of Law, Presidency University, Bangalore does not offer an offline application process for its BA LLB program. All applications are required to be submitted online through the university's official website. Candidates can access the online application form by visiting the university's website and following the instructions provided. The online application process involves filling out the form with personal and educational details, uploading required documents, and paying the application fee online. It's essential to ensure that all information provided in the application is accurate and complete to avoid any issues during the admission process.

No, School of Law, Presidency University, Bangalore does not offer direct admission to its BA LLB programme without any entrance exam. Admission to the BA LLB programme is based on the candidate's performance in the Common Law Admission Test (CLAT) or other national-level law entrance exams recognised by the Bar Council of India (BCI). Candidates who meet the eligibility criteria and score the required marks in the entrance exam are eligible for admission to the BA LLB programme at School of Law, Presidency University, Bangalore.

The BA LLB course at the School of Law, Presidency University, Bangalore, costs INR 1,40,000 for the first year of the program. The total fees for the 5-year course are INR 7,00,000. The fee structure includes components other than tuition fees, such as seat booking and other miscellaneous charges. The total hostel fee for the BA LLB (Hons.) program at School of Law, Presidency University, Bangalore is INR 1.80 lakhs, making the total cost INR 8.80 lakhs for the entire 5-year program.

Candidates who meet the following eligibility criteria are eligible to apply for BA LLB at School of Law, Presidency University, Bangalore:1. Academic Qualification: Candidates should have passed their 10+2 or equivalent examination from a recognised board with a minimum of 45% marks (40% for SC/ST/PwD candidates). Candidates appearing for their final year exams in March/April are also eligible to apply, provided they submit their mark sheets by the specified date.2. Age Limit: Candidates should be between 17 and 22 years of age as on July 1st of the year of admission (relaxation of 3 years for SC/ST/PwD candidates).3. English Proficiency: Candidates should have studied English as a compulsory subject at the 10+2 level or equivalent.4. Nationality: Candidates should be Indian nationals.5. Entrance Exam: Candidates should have appeared for and secured the minimum qualifying marks in the Common Law Admission Test (CLAT) conducted by any CLAT-consortium law school. The minimum CLAT score required for admission to BA LLB at School of Law, Presidency University, Bangalore may vary from year to year based on the number of applicants and the difficulty level of the exam.After meeting these eligibility criteria, shortlisted candidates will be called for document verification and an interview at School of Law, Presidency University, Bangalore. Based on their performance in these rounds, candidates will be selected for admission to the BA LLB programme at School of Law, Presidency University, Bangalore.

Graduates of BA LLB from School of Law, Presidency University, Bangalore have excellent career prospects in various fields of law and related areas. Some of the career options for BA LLB graduates from this university are:1. Litigation: Graduates can pursue a career in litigation by practicing law in courts, tribunals, and other legal forums.2. Corporate Law: BA LLB graduates can work in corporate houses, law firms, and other organizations in the capacity of legal advisors, compliance officers, or company secretaries.3. Judiciary: After completing their BA LLB degree, graduates can apply for judicial services exams to become judges at various levels of the judiciary.4. Legal Research: Graduates can pursue a career in legal research by working as legal researchers, analysts, or consultants in law firms, academic institutions, and other organizations.5. Public Service: BA LLB graduates can also apply for various government jobs in the legal department of ministries, departments, and other government agencies.6. Entrepreneurship: Graduates can start their own law firms or legal consultancy firms after completing their BA LLB degree.7. Academics: Graduates can also pursue a career in academics by joining law colleges or universities as faculty members or research scholars.
